Overview

Kolleno displays dates based on your browser’s language and regional settings. To adjust the date format (e.g., from MM/DD/YYYY to DD/MM/YYYY), you’ll need to update the settings in your browser.

For example, in Google Chrome, switching to the UK date format is quick and easy.

How to Change Date Format in Chrome

  1. Open Chrome Settings:
    Click the three-dot menu in the top right corner and select Settings.

  2. Go to Languages:
    In the left-hand menu, select Languages.

  3. Add or Select English (United Kingdom):

    • If it's not listed, click Add languages and select it.

    • Drag it to the top of the list or click the three dots next to it and choose "Display Google Chrome in this language".

  4. Restart Chrome (if needed):
    The change should take effect automatically, but restarting the browser can help ensure it's applied.

Once updated, your date format in Kolleno will reflect your new regional settings (e.g., DD/MM/YYYY for UK).
